Html主体内部的角度组件
我是个新手,如果这有点傻的话,请容忍我 我试图添加一个标签内的角度主要组成部分,有背景图像。但这张图片并没有覆盖整个页面。它在上面省去了一些空间,即浏览器地址栏和图像之间的空间 这是我的app.component.htmlHtml主体内部的角度组件,html,css,Html,Css,我是个新手,如果这有点傻的话,请容忍我 我试图添加一个标签内的角度主要组成部分,有背景图像。但这张图片并没有覆盖整个页面。它在上面省去了一些空间,即浏览器地址栏和图像之间的空间 这是我的app.component.html <body class="landing-bg-image" style="padding-bottom: 300px;"> </body> Stackblitz网址: 截图: 尝试使用bowser inspect element工具检查bodyh
<body class="landing-bg-image" style="padding-bottom: 300px;">
</body>
Stackblitz网址:
截图:
尝试使用bowser inspect element工具检查bodyhtml元素。并尝试查找主体的填充样式属性。并更新填充属性,如下所述: 填充:0px重要 多亏了@JunKang 将
body
移动到index.html文件(边距为零)并在body中添加组件(具有带背景的div)解决了问题
STACKBLITURL:
可能是因为<代码> /COD>有8px的默认余量。请考虑提供一个可能的…普朗克,西德?这样的话,志愿者们就更有可能帮助你们了。嗨@JunKang,应用边际:0px!重要的;但还是不走运。我看过你的闪电战。不要将边距:0
放在应用程序组件css中。将其放入style.css文件中,如下所示:body{margin:0;}
您正在应用程序组件内放置一个
标记,该标记是您在app.component.css中使用css更改的标记。您可能应该将应用程序组件中的
标记改为div。谢谢@JunKang,这是我的错误。
p {
font-family: Lato;
}
.landing-bg-image {
background-size: auto 100vh;
background: #0a1215 url(../images/back-image.jpg) no-repeat;
background-origin: content-box;
}